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of water source testing, and in particular to a sealing structure for a portable water quality testing device. Background Technology

[0002] With the development of environmental monitoring and water resource management, the demand for rapid on-site water quality testing is increasing. The sealed structure of portable water quality testing devices can adapt to various harsh environments, ensuring that the internal testing components are not affected by external environmental factors.

[0003] Early, simple portable water quality testing devices used a simple rubber ring sealing structure, which would deform over time, leading to a decrease in sealing performance. Current sealing structures enhance sealing through a tight fit between the sealing ring and the sealing cap. After water quality testing, residual water is cleaned with pure distilled water to avoid introducing new impurities that could affect subsequent test results. However, some water residue remains inside the instrument after cleaning. This residue can breed microorganisms that multiply rapidly, contaminating subsequent water samples and affecting the accuracy of test results. Furthermore, it can corrode the sealing structure itself, reducing sealing performance and shortening the device's lifespan. Utility Model Content

[0004] To overcome the above shortcomings, this utility model provides a sealing structure for a portable water quality testing device, which aims to improve the problem of water stains remaining after cleaning in the prior art.

[0020] This utility model has the following beneficial effects:

[0021] 1. In this utility model, after the water sample test is completed, the sealing cap is removed, the water sample in the base is poured out, and the sample is rinsed with distilled water. Then, the sealing cap is put back on, the top button is pressed, and the round rod is rotated and moved downwards. This causes the fixing block, spring, and sponge block to move downwards in sequence. When the sponge block contacts the bottom of the instrument, it absorbs residual water stains. Excess pressure is converted into elastic potential energy by the spring and stored. When the button is released, the spring returns to its original state, thus avoiding damage to the instrument, ensuring that the sponge block absorbs water efficiently, and preventing water stains from causing microbial growth.

[0022] 2. In this utility model, when testing a water sample, the water sample is poured into the partition on the inner wall of the base. The sealing cover is then placed on top, causing the limiting ring to move downwards. When the limiting ring contacts the partition, the anti-slip concave block on its inner wall engages with the anti-slip protrusion on the outer wall of the partition. At the same time, the magnetic ring attracts the partition, making the sealing cover fit tightly against the instrument, forming a closed space. During testing, the squeezing cotton at the top of the inner wall of the base squeezes the partition, filling tiny gaps, preventing air and impurities from entering and water sample leakage, enhancing the sealing performance, and ensuring accurate and reliable test data. [0039] Working principle: After the water sample is tested, remove the sealing cap 3 from the instrument and slowly and thoroughly pour out the water sample from the base 1. Then, slowly pour pure distilled water into the base 1 to rinse away the water sample and impurities. After cleaning, tightly attach the sealing cap 3 to the instrument and press the button 4. The button 4 drives the round rod 5, causing the threaded groove 6 to rotate through the threaded connection of the sealing cap 3. As the round rod 5 rotates downwards, it sequentially drives the fixing block 7, spring 8, and sponge block 10 to move downwards synchronously. When the sponge block 10 rotates and gradually approaches the bottom of the instrument and finally contacts it, it will draw out the water. The instrument collects residual water stains. When the sponge block 10 contacts the bottom, the excess pressure is converted into elastic potential energy and stored by the spring 8. Then, the button 4 is pulled back to its original position. At the same time, the pressure on the spring 8 is released, thus restoring the instrument to its original state. This buffer not only effectively prevents scratches and deformation damage to the bottom of the instrument due to excessive pressure, but also ensures that the spring 8 has low elasticity and will not put excessive pressure on the sponge block 10. This perfectly solves the problem of microbial growth and reproduction caused by water stains inside the instrument, providing a clean and sterile environment for the next test.

[0040] Furthermore, through the sealing mechanism 2, when testing the water sample, the water sample is slowly poured into the interior of the partition 201. The sealing cover 3 drives the limiting ring 205 to move downward. When the limiting ring 205 moves downward to contact the partition 201, the anti-slip concave block 206 on the inner wall of the limiting ring 205 engages with the anti-slip protrusion 202 on the partition 201. At the same time, the magnetic suction ring 204 on the inner wall of the limiting ring 205 is tightly fitted with the partition 201, and the sealing cover 3 is tightly fitted with the instrument, forming a closed testing space. During the testing process, the squeezing cotton 203 at the top of the inner wall of the base 1 will squeeze the partition 201. This squeezing action further fills the existing tiny gaps, preventing external air and impurities from entering the testing space, and also preventing water sample leakage. This greatly enhances the sealing performance of the instrument, thereby effectively improving the accuracy of water sample testing and ensuring the reliability of the test data.
